Great Uncle Alford, stepped out of his tank in France when a shell landed nearby blasting a tree on him. Buried in Ft. Snelling.

If you've ever wondered what all those old buildings are at the end of 30R in MSP that's part of Ft. Snelling. The Vets cemetery is on the the south side of 30L. Put down your phone and look over that way when your in the hotel shuttle, you will see the white crosses.
The entire airport is built on old Ft. Snelling.
